The corrosion-resistant, cast aluminum frame on this fully enclosed winch makes it perfect for marine use. Other unique features include adjustable handle length and configuration, an easy-to-use pawl knob and a dual-gear drum.


Features:

  • Completely enclosed design is durable and stylish
    • Cast aluminum frame provides corrosion resistance
  • Aluminum, soft-grip handle offers ultimate adjustability
    • Switch from right- to left-handed drive configuration
    • Adjust the handle length from 6" - 9" to balance torque, speed and clearance
  • Quick and easy installation - fits industry standard mounting pattern
    • All necessary mounting hardware included
  • Pull-and-turn knob easily engages and disengages pawl
    • No exposed spring
  • Dual-gear drum and solid drive gear allow smooth, reliable operation
  • Handle can be turned in reverse to slowly let out cable instead of freespooling
  • Rear strap guide helps to prevent strap from contacting gears
    • Strap included


Specs:

  • Handle length: adjusts from 6" - 9"
  • Mounting base measures 3-3/8" long
  • Gear ratio: 5.1:1
  • Hub diameter: 7/8"
  • Drum storage: 20' x 2" strap
    • For use with strap only
  • Capacity: 2,000 lbs
  • Limited lifetime warranty

See what our Experts say about this Fulton Trailer Winch

  • Recommended Marine Hand Winch For 3000-Lb Boat
    I have attached a link to a helpful article that explains how to choose the correct winch for a boat trailer. Here is what the article says: Finding the Right Capacity Winch for your Boat Trailer. Boat-size-to-winch capacity is generally 2 to 1 With good rollers and short winching distances, increase the ratio to 3 to 1 With wooden bunks and long winching distances, reduce the ratio to 1 to 1 For example, a 2,200-lb boat generally requires a 1,100-lb winch.   • Dimensions, Mounting Pattern and Strap for Fulton F2 Fully Enclosed Trailer Winch # FW20000301
    The Fulton F2 Fully Enclosed Trailer Winch with Adjustable Handle, # FW20000301, measures 10 inches long, 8 inches high, and 8 inches wide with the hand on. The base is 3-1/2 inches by 6-1/8 inches. The industry standard mounting pattern is basically a triangle-shaped bolt pattern. The two bolts at the bottom are 2-1/4 inches apart on center.   • Can the Fulton F2 2K Trailer Winch Handle a 1,800 Pound Boat
    The gear ratio for Fulton F2 winch # FW20000301 is 5.1:1. The capacity of the winch at 2,000 pounds is enough to pull the 1,800 pound boat even in the worst conditions (those being a long winching distance, steep incline, wooden bunk are all of the above). If you have roller bunks the ratio for winch capacity could increase to 2 to 1 or even 3 to 1 in some cases. That would mean that in certain conditions the winch can handle a boat up to 6,000 pounds.   • How to Choose a Hand Winch for a Tow Dolly
    In order to choose the correct winch for your application, you would need to know both the weight of the vehicle and degree of the incline the winch must overcome to pull the vehicle onto the dolly. On level ground, a winch can pull 10 times its capacity if the load is rolling. For example, a winch rated at 1,600 lbs while pulling a rolling load can handle up to 16,000 lbs.   • What is the Mounting Pattern for Fulton F2 2K Winch
    The Fulton F2 winch # FW20000301 uses an industry standard mounting pattern. The industry standard mounting pattern is basically a triangle-shaped bolt pattern. The two bolts at the bottom are 2-1/4 inches apart on center. The top bolt is 4-1/2 inches from either bottom bolt on center. On this winch you can adjust where the center bolt is since it is a slotted hole in case you need to make some slight adjustments.
